THE TREND<br />

BARELY<br />

THERE<br />

It’s you, only better! This trend is<br />

all about ‘has she or hasn’t she<br />

coloured her hair?’ This can be<br />

harder to achieve than all-over<br />

colour; it might look like the<br />

hair hasn’t been coloured, but<br />

that is where the skill lies. “It’s<br />

all about subtle enhancement<br />

rather than masking their true<br />

hair colour,” explains Sean Nolan,<br />

head of technical at HOB Salons.<br />

Sean suggests using Wella<br />

Professionals’ Illumina Gloss as<br />

this highlights the hair’s natural<br />

tone without blanket coverage.<br />

Steph Peckmore, group colour<br />

director at Bad Apple, believes<br />

‘nude’ hair is going to be big in<br />

2018. “It’s the new sun-kissed<br />

– it’s great for women who<br />

just want a beautiful, luxurious<br />

finish to their hair,” she says.<br />

Warren Boodaghians, TIGI global<br />

academy technical director,<br />

sees the trend in make-up for<br />

sheer, nude colours coming<br />

through into hair. “Just as<br />

make-up can enhance the<br />

wearer’s complexion and eye<br />

colouring, sheer hair colouring<br />

techniques can add gloss and<br />

shine, enhancing natural tones.<br />

‘Natural colour’ is all about<br />

multi-dimensional and universal<br />

colouring as opposed to opaque<br />

colours,” says Warren. Denis de<br />

Souza, Joico celebrity colourist,<br />

is known for his ‘natural-isbetter’<br />

approach to colour and<br />

believes the best way to achieve<br />

this trend is by “creating a<br />

stretched root effect”. He says:<br />

“Choose a colour similar to<br />

your client’s natural hair so it<br />

will grow in seamlessly.” To keep<br />

their hair looking ‘nearly natural’,<br />

Denis suggests using Joico<br />

LumiShine followed by Joico<br />

K-Pak Color Therapy.<br />
